The solutions aren’t integrated (properly). ?No comprehensive solution does everything on its own. ?That’s why the integration process is vital to the on-going (and sustained) success of your entire enterprise.? Simply put, the solutions you need must work together cohesively. ?But all APIs are not created equal.? While other providers are quick to tout their lengthy list of integrations, the integration process is akin to the famous E.T. movie poster in which E.T. and Elliott’s fingers touch--but never intersect.? In a true integration, all digits must intersect—not only for strength, but also for added value.? Assembling a tech Frankenstein from disconnected vendors may give you more data, but you’ll have less insight, as the ability to see this holistic data—joined together and parsed in meaningful ways—will be greatly diminished. ?By having an aligned system, you’ll maximize successes, minimize frustrations, and ensure your ability to make real-time decisions about the true health of your F&B operations.
The tech tools are complex. ?It’s easy to fall for the bells and whistles of a new tech solution, but one of your top concerns should be whether it’s user friendly (powerful, yes... but easy to learn, use, and manage). ?If the solution is overly complicated, your staff won’t use (or like) it. ?Avoid solutions that are complex or have a steep learning curve. When you focus on intuitive, simple-to-use solutions, your daily operations will be simplified, your staff will save time and effort, and your guests will be empowered with resources that will enable them to seamlessly (and contactlessly) order more of your great food and beverages.

Security is an afterthought. ?While strict adherence to PCI DSS, the data security standards enacted by the Payment Card Industry, helps protect card data, non-card data cybercrime (exploits such as ransomware, viruses, malware, phishing, etc.) can also wreak costly havoc on your enterprise.? Determine if (and how) a tech solution will increase your attack surface—and find out what security measures your POS provider takes. ?Best practice: Select a provider that is PCI DSS compliant as a service provider, utilizes in-house PCI QIR certified installers, and employs an in-house team of certified security experts who perform security essentials, including monitoring, testing, and issue remediation.
You didn’t consider the ROI. ?The right tech solutions can drive revenue growth, cut costs, attract new customers, ensure guest loyalty, increase productivity, and help elevate your most important asset: your valued brand. ?While tech solutions require an initial investment, the right option—especially those that are agile, innovative, and highly scalable—will pay for itself over time. ?Before investing in new technology, consider the ROI you’re expecting. ?Do you want to reduce food waste, sustainably increase sales, gain guest loyalty, adopt guest empowerment solutions, become more operationally efficient...? ?Determine whether the tech solutions you’re contemplating can help you improve these metrics. ?If they can’t, you’re likely considering the wrong solution for your F&B needs.?
